Last week, Kevin Weir of Action Coach told me that it takes up to seven "touches" with a prospect to make them into a client. This number astounded me! I have to confess that I expect to convert a prospect into a customer much faster than that. However, he clarified that part of that process is education.

He said if you spend time educating people about what it is you do, then part of those touches are informational/educational.

This work of educating regarding PRSA is no different than what people would do in their business. Whether you run your own company, or work for someone else, we all end up selling the ideas, services or products of the company to others. If we start with the WHY and help educate others about the value of what the company does, we will be ahead of the game.
